Maintain accurate work order status throughout all stages of cable manufacturing. Review planned work orders prior to release, ensuring raw materials—such as copper rod, aluminum, insulation compounds, shielding tapes, and jacketing materials—are available and meet specification. Release planned orders in alignment with production priorities, material readiness, and machine center availability, following guidance and strategic direction from the Senior Planner. Plan, order, and control component and raw‑material inventories, spending most of the time analyzing reports, performing calculations, and entering data into the MRP/ERP system. Collaborate with factory personnel on the production floor to resolve material constraints, verify spool availability, and coordinate machine sequencing. Use material‑availability and expediting tools to confirm readiness of key inputs such as conductor wire, insulation pellets, color concentrates, and packaging materials. Monitor work center schedules for extrusion lines, cabling machines, and jacketing cells; dispatch work orders to maintain continuous flow and minimize changeovers. Participate in daily meetings with shop supervision to review progress, identify bottlenecks, and adjust schedules based on material or equipment constraints. Establish and maintain priority sequencing among work orders to support on‑time delivery of cable reels and cut‑to‑length orders. Escalate unresolvable schedule or material issues—such as supplier delays, compound shortages, or machine downtime—to the Senior Planner and VSM. Participate in weekly plant scheduling meetings to ensure achievable production and shipping commitments. Prepare and maintain departmental reports, including material‑usage summaries, schedule adherence, and inventory health. Apply Lean methodologies—Kanban, Supermarkets, FIFO lanes, and visual controls—to improve material flow and scheduling efficiency across cable‑manufacturing operations. Support the Senior Planner in implementing and reviewing production‑planning KPIs; collaborate with internal stakeholders to develop corrective action plans. Assist in creating new process plans and planning strategies when new cable constructions or customer‑specific designs are introduced. Contribute to functional capacity planning for extrusion, cabling, and jacketing equipment to support long‑term demand. Participate in daily and weekly production‑status meetings with cross‑functional teams including engineering, purchasing, quality, and operations. Perform diversified duties across MRP, Production Control, and manufacturing environments, supporting continuous improvement in material flow and scheduling accuracy. Maintain frequent communication with factory supervision, engineering, and purchasing to ensure alignment on priorities and material requirements.
